# Index Command
|
||||
|
||||
The `index` management command is used to index documents to the remote search indexer.
|
||||
|
||||
## Usage
|
||||
|
||||
### Make Command
|
||||
|
||||
```bash
|
||||
# Basic usage with defaults
|
||||
make index
|
||||
|
||||
# With custom parameters
|
||||
make index args="--batch-size 100 --lower-time-bound 2024-01-01T00:00:00 --upper-time-bound 2026-01-01T00:00:00"
|
||||
|
||||
```
|
||||
|
||||
### Command line
|
||||
|
||||
```bash
|
||||
python manage.py index \
|
||||
--lower-time-bound "2024-01-01T00:00:00" \
|
||||
--upper-time-bound "2024-01-31T23:59:59" \
|
||||
--batch-size 200 \
|
||||
--async
|
||||
```
|
||||
|
||||
### Django Admin
|
||||
|
||||
The command is available in the Django admin interface:
|
||||
|
||||
1. Go to `/admin/run-indexing/`, you arrive at the "Run Indexing Command" page
|
||||
2. Fill in the form with the desired parameters
|
||||
3. Click **"Run Indexing Command"**
|
||||
|
||||
## Parameters
|
||||
|
||||
### `--batch-size`
|
||||
- **type:** Integer
|
||||
- **default:** `settings.SEARCH_INDEXER_BATCH_SIZE`
|
||||
- **description:** Number of documents to process per batch. Higher values may improve performance but use more memory.
|
||||
|
||||
### `--lower-time-bound`
|
||||
- **optional**: true
|
||||
- **type:** ISO 8601 datetime string
|
||||
- **default:** `None`
|
||||
- **description:** Only documents updated after this date will be indexed.
|
||||
|
||||
### `--upper-time-bound`
|
||||
- **optional**: true
|
||||
- **type:** ISO 8601 datetime string
|
||||
- **default:** `None`
|
||||
- **description:** Only documents updated before this date will be indexed.
|
||||
|
||||
### `--async`
|
||||
- **type:** Boolean flag
|
||||
- **default:** `False`
|
||||
+- **description:** When set, dispatches the indexing job to a Celery worker instead of running it synchronously.
|
||||
|
||||
## Crash Safe Mode
|
||||
|
||||
The command saves the `updated_at` of the last document of each successful batch into the `bulk-indexer-checkpoint` cache variable.
|
||||
If the process crashes, this value can be used as `lower-time-bound` to resume from the last successfully indexed document.
